    Keystone pipeline would not raise domestic production, it was a conduit to get oil to the southern coast to then sell it to Europe.

    The U.S. is still a net exporter and rising gas prices actually helps the U.S. oil industry, it's becoming very clear that have no clue how this works.

    You might want to read this.

    https://www.eia.gov/energyexplained...ermined,materials from producers to consumers.

    Crude oil prices are determined by global supply and demand. Economic growth is one of the biggest factors affecting petroleum product—and therefore crude oil—demand. Growing economies increase demand for energy in general and especially for transporting goods and materials from producers to consumers.

    U.S. oil goes to wherever they can get the best price, it does not matter what's happening at home.
